Domain Registration and “How much is my Domain Name worth?”

The value of a domain registration could be based on many criteria to value it and it could be change from time to time. We would like to point out 4 main  criteria that we think that they are the key value to valuate the domain.

Characters – The shorter the better!
There is no doubt about it. Short names are better than long names. They are generally easier to remember,spell, and are more impactful.

Commerce
Ultimately, the value of a Domain Name is driven by its ability to deliver traffic and revenue to a business (good keyword domain). This determines how much a company would pay for a Domain Name. The size of the business opportunity most apparent for the name drives the value. For example, house.com is more valuable than smoking.com. Names that are simple, very well-known phrases or words without an obvious business use are also valuable since these can be easily branded. An example of such a name is Monster.com.

Names with potential trademark issues are generally worthless. People who spend good money on names that are the trademark of a company are wasting their time and money because these companies are going after these owners. They must do this under most countries’ trademark rules or they risk losing their trademarks. Think about that before you register IPhone.abc in a new registry.

Names that are variants or related to the most used version of the name in commerce are also diminished in value. For example, phone.com is more valuable than cellphone.com and nice.com is more valuable than verynice.com.

.Com domain
Many people want to live in exclusive Beverly Hills, New York City, Paris, Singapore or Hong Kong. That’s what drives up value. On the Internet, everyone wants to live in the .Com neighborhood. It’s the exclusive top level domain that says “I’ve been in this business a long time, I am a serious player, and I know what I’m doing.” It’s the instant branding that drives up the value, pure and simple, because all the other top-level domains generally work just as well.

About Country Code Top-Level Domains (ccTLD) & Top-level domains (TLD)

What Are Country Code Top-Level Domains (ccTLD)?

Country-code TLDs (ccTLDs) represent specific geographic locations.

Domain registration example: .mx represents Mexico and .eu represents the European Union. Some ccTLDs have residency restrictions. For example, .eu requires registrants to live or be located in a country belonging to the European Union. Other ccTLDs, like the ccTLD .it representing Italy, allow anyone to register them, but require a trustee service if the registrant is not located in a specified country or region. Finally, there are ccTLDs that can be registered by anyone — .co representing Colombia, for example, has no residency requirements at all.

What Are Top-level domains (TLD)?

A top-level domain (TLD) is the part of the domain name located to the right of the dot (” . “). The most common TLDs are .com, .net, and .org. Some others are .biz, .info, and .ws. These common TLDs all have certain guidelines, but are generally available to any registrant, anywhere in the world.

There are also restricted top-level domains (rTLDs), like .aero, .biz, .edu, .mil, .museum, .name, and .pro, that require the registrant to represent a certain type of entity, or to belong to a certain community. For example, the .name TLD is reserved for individuals, and .edu is reserved for educational entities.

Domain Registration – Nameserver Rules for .IT Domains

Nameserver requirements

Nameserver features Details
IPv4 Supported
IPv6 Not supported
DNSSEC Not supported
Minimum # of nameservers 2
Maximum # of nameservers 6

All .it domain names must have two to six authoritative nameservers. Before you register or update the domain name, you must list all of these nameservers – including any 3rd party nameservers – in its zone file. Additionally, all IP addresses on the nameservers created do need to be unique IP addresses. If all nameservers are not listed, the domain name will fail the registry check.

If you want to register a .it domain name with us and use our nameservers, we handle this process for you.

If you want to use your own nameservers, you must set them up before you register or update the domain name. You must also ensure that they are resolving properly before you assign them to the domain name in our system.

TIP: You can use a DNS validation tool to ensure that your nameservers are resolving properly. If you do not have a preferred DNS validator, you can use any search engine to find one.

For example, if you want to register coolexample.com.it and use the nameserversns1.coolexample.it and ns2.coolexample.it, then you must list those nameservers in the domain name’s zone file.

After you set up your nameservers and register or update your domain name, use the instructions in Change nameservers for my domains to set the nameservers in our system. Then, the Registro.it registry must approve or reject them, which can take up to five business days.

Domains are not activated until the domain’s nameservers are successfully checked by the registry.

Nameservers for a .IT domain registration must be correctly configured before the registration request succeeds, otherwise registration will fail. Please check that the following requirements are met:

  • There must be at least 2 authoritative nameservers for the domain name, and they must correspond exactly to those found in the registration of the domain name
  • The IP addresses of hosts in the registration of the domain name must correspond to those actually associated with them in the DNS
  • The domain name cannot be associated with a CNAME record
  • The name of the nameserver specified in the SOA record for the domain name cannot be a CNAME
  • The names of the authoritative nameservers for the domain name cannot be CNAMEs
  • If there is an MX registration it cannot be associated with a CNAME
  • All hosts in the registration must be authoritative for the domain name registered

Forwarded Emails and Private Domain Registration

Respond to Forwarded Emails
Protect yourself from spam, scams, and prying eyes.

Private Domain Registration creates a unique email address for each domain name. When someone sends a message to the email address that Private Registration creates for you, that email is routed according to the forwarding preference you set for your account. You can set your account to forward your email without filtering it, filter it for spam and then forward it, or not forward it at all.

For security purposes, messages are forwarded from a “do not reply” email address. Therefore, you cannot reply directly to forwarded messages. If you attempt to send a reply to a forwarded message, you’ll receive an error message. This security measure ensures the privacy of your personal email address and prevents you from mistakenly exposing it.

To respond to a forwarded message, you must compose a new email message in the email account of your choice. You can find the sender’s email address in the subject line of the forwarded email message.

If you send a new email message, you willingly expose your personal email address to the recipient.

Do You Need Private Domain Registration?

What is Private Domain Registration?

The Internet Corporation for Assigned Names and Numbers (ICANN) requires that we make the contact information associated with domain registration available to the public via the Whois directory. The Whois database is an online repository of information associated with registered domain names. It stores and publicly displays domain name information, such creation and expiration dates, the registrar of record, and its various contacts (registrant, billing, administrative, and technical). Private domain registration is a service that hides personal domain name contact information like your name, address, email address, and phone number from the public.

Domain Registration – About .co Domain Names

The .co country-code top-level domain name (ccTLD) is an extension that represents Colombia. The information below also applies to the following country-code second-level domain registration (ccSLDs):

  • .com.co — Intended for commercial entities
  • .net.co — Intended for network infrastructures, such as Internet Service Providers (ISPs)
  • .nom.co — Intended for private individuals

Renewal Restrictions

You must renew your .co domain name by its expiration date.

If you set your domain name to auto-renew, we make the first renewal attempt on the morning of the day your .co domain name expires. If the renewal attempt fails, we re-attempt renewal five days after the expiration date. If the second renewal attempt fails, we make a final auto-renewal attempt 12 days after the expiration date.

For example: Your .co domain name expires on July 19. If you did not set the domain name to auto-renew, you can renew it manually by July 19. For automatic renewals, we attempt to renew the domain name on July 19, July 24, and July 31.

If we cannot auto-renew the domain name and you did not manually renew it by its expiration date, you can attempt to recover it, and there might be a fee to do so.

.CO Internet SAS parks your domain name five days after expiration if you do not renew or recover it.

If you are unable to recover the domain name, we can attempt to redeem it for you, but there is a fee for the redemption. Contact our technical support team for assistance.
